 Recitation Problem:

 

    You are scuba-diving in a karstic cave system near a landfill and you come across a large,

        trapped air bubble. You sample the bubble with your portable gas chromatograph    

        and find that the bubble contains benzene at a partial pressure of 0.12 atm (benzene: C6H6 is

        a common carcinogenic organic pollutant). Assume STP (i.e. Temperature is 25 deg C and 

        total pressure in the bubble is 1 atm.

 

         KH for benzene is 5.5 atm*L*mol-1 at 25 deg C

 

(a)   What is the concentration of benzene in the bubble in ppmv?

 

(b)  Assuming the bubble is in equilibrium with the water,

       what is the concentration in mg/l of benzene in the cave water?

 

(c)  How does this compare to the MCL (EPA maximum concentration levels

        for drinking water)  MCL for benzene is 5 µg/l?
